Victor Hammond(1893-1974)

  • Writer
  • Camera and Electrical Department
IMDbProStarmeterSee rank
Victor Hammond was born on 14 December 1893 in Naples, Italy. He was a writer, known for Fashion Model (1945), Detective Kitty O'Day (1944) and In Fast Company (1946). He died on 6 September 1974 in Los Angeles, California, USA.
